Maintenance Tips of MG 10770603YEL Connecting Rod Bearing for MG5
- Firstly, before installing the Connecting Rod Bearing (OE# 10770603YEL) in your MG5, thoroughly clean the rod and the crankshaft journal to remove any debris. Secondly, ensure the bearing is correctly sized for the MG engine to prevent excessive wear. Thirdly, apply a thin layer of high - quality engine oil to the bearing surface for smooth operation. Fourthly, check the bearing clearance using a feeler gauge according to the MG5's specifications. Fifthly, install the bearing with the correct orientation as marked on the Connecting Rod Bearing, which is crucial for proper function.
Caution: Over - tightening the bolts when installing the Connecting Rod Bearing (OE# 10770603YEL) in your MG5 can lead to bearing damage and engine failure.
